    摘要: The present inventors conducted a similarity search of the amino acid sequence of known G protein-coupled receptor proteins in GenBank, and obtained a novel human GPCR gene “BG37”, cDNA containing the ORF of the gene was cloned and its nucleotide sequence was determined. Moreover, novel GPCR “BG37” genes from mouse and rat were isolated. Use of the novel GPCR of the present invention enables screening of ligands, compounds inhibiting the binding to a ligand, and candidate compounds of pharmaceuticals which can regulate signal transduction from the “BG37” receptor.

    摘要: A benzothiazole derivative represented by the general formula: ##STR1## wherein X represents --NHR, --R or --OR group in which R is a lower alkyl, cycloalkyl, aryl or substituted aryl group;Y represents a lower alkyl, alkenyl, alkyloxycarbonylalkyl, benzyl or substituted benzyl group; andZ represents a lower alkoxy group or a hydrogen atom.This compound is useful as an active ingredient of an agricultural and horticultural fungicide.

    摘要: An aqueous adhesive composition which comprises 0.5 to 30 parts by weight, as solids, of an aqueous cationic polyamide polyamine epichlorohydrin resin solution per 100 parts by weight, as solids, of an aqueous, cationic or nonionic polymer dispersion exhibits not only excellent water resistance despite their room-temperature drying properties, when applied to various kinds of substrates but also exceptionally improved storage stability.The aqueous cationic or nonionic polymer dispersion may be a dispersion of polymerized ethylenically unsaturated monomers.

    摘要: A pattern recognition apparatus and method in which a set is produced which includes a fundamental pattern vector on a basis place and other fundamental pattern vectors of the patterns displaced from the fundamental pattern on the basis place. Then a subspace spanned by fundamental pattern vectors included in the set is generated. A test pattern vector of a wafer to be inspected is projected to the subspace and similarity between the fundamental vectors and the test pattern vector is measured. Further, an image is used after it is filtered by a normalization filter. Furthermore, sensitivity of pattern recognition is varied by changing the dimension of the pattern vectors. Moreover, for objects expressed by numerical values which can not be compared directly, the data of the objects are transformed into images and, then, a set of fundamental pattern vectors are worked out.
